风险因素
- Cash-flow pressure if ramp-up stretches beyond the 3–5 month break-even window
- Revenue concentration risk if performance depends on staying near the $25,200 low end rather than scaling toward $43,200
- Margin compression from higher-than-expected costs, eroding the $11,144–$24,104 monthly profit range
- Competitive intensity in the area (450 nearby competitors) reducing member acquisition efficiency
- Local purchasing power risk if GDP/capita ($32,487) limits discretionary spend for memberships
执行计划
- Set a 90-day opening plan with capped class slots, coach staffing, and membership tiers tailored to Niigata demand
- Pre-sell memberships and run free intro weeks to accelerate utilization and hit the expected 3–5 month break-even
- Differentiate with CrossFit fundamentals (beginner onboarding), measurable programming, and community events to improve retention
- Target efficient lead acquisition via local SEO (“CrossFit 新潟”), Google Business Profile, and partnerships with nearby fitness/health providers
- Implement KPI dashboards (leads, trial-to-member conversion, class attendance, churn) and adjust programming weekly to protect profit margin
- Diversify revenue with small add-ons (nutrition coaching, personal training, seasonal challenges) to reduce reliance on core dues
